Job Summary
Support France programs by coaching Trip Experience Leaders, gathering live traveler feedback, and developing practical training plans to ensure high-quality delivery. Manage on-the-road operations by handling changes, delays, or service issues with professionalism while maintaining service standards under pressure. Build trusted relationships with field teams through consistent communication and provide clear, constructive feedback to align with company standards. Travel up to 70% of the time during high season to train guides and tour leaders. This role requires fluency in French and English, along with strong problem-solving skills and a passion for authentic cultural experiences.
